Displaying RMON Statistics

To display the statistics for any index, proceed as follows:
1. Use the arrow keys to highlight the PORT field at the bottom of the screen.
2. Type the Port number into the PORT field.
3. Press ENTER (neither the RMON Statistics Port field nor the statistics will change until ENTER
is pressed).

UNICAST ADDRESS TABLE
Screen Navigation Path
Password > Main Menu > Network Monitor Menu > Unicast Address Table
When to Use
To search for a specific address, clear the entire address table or information associated with a
specific address, or set the aging time for deleting inactive entries. This screen contains the MAC
addresses and VLAN identifier associated with each port (that is, the source port associated with
the address and VLAN), sorted by MAC address or VLAN ID.
How to Access
Use the arrow keys to highlight the Unicast Address Table menu item on the Network Monitor
Menu screen and press ENTER. The Unicast Address Table screen,
